Главная страница


ru.linux

 
 - RU.LINUX ---------------------------------------------------------------------
 From : Konstantin Isakov                    2:5020/2046.4  24 Aug 2001  16:50:36
 To : Maxim Zubkov
 Subject : Kernel 2.4.8
 -------------------------------------------------------------------------------- 
 
 Maxim,
 
 23 Авг 01 23:30, Maxim Zubkov(2:5030/889) wrote to Konstantin
 Isakov(2:5020/2046.4):
 
  MZ>>>> Естественно.Там все проходит нормально.
  MZ>>>> ХОтя вопрос снят.Помогло поднятие версии ядра до 2.4.9.
 
 Кстати, что за вопрос-то был? Может, мне тоже надо апгрейдить до 2.4.9?
 
  AZ>>> Я чего-то не понимаю ? Проблемы с микшером только у меня что-ли ?
  AZ>>> ps: а /dev/sequencer заработал у кого-нибудь на emu10k1 ?
  KI>> Заработал. У меня все пашет на ура, не хуже, чем в винде. Если
  KI>> интересно, могу изложить процесс того, как это делается.
 
  MZ> Если не сложно,plz.
 
 Да все там просто. Перво-наперво, качаем последнюю alsa с www.alsa-project.org.
 Ставим по инструкции (не забываем убрать из кернела все драйвера, оставив
 разрешенным только Sound Support)...
 
 при запуске ./configure для драйверов указываем ключик --with-sequencer=yes
 
 Поставили драйвера, либы, утили... настроили modules.conf по инструкции,
 у меня так, можете брать в неизменном виде:
 
 === cat me >> /etc/modules.conf ========
 
 # ALSA portion
 
 alias char-major-116 snd
 options snd snd_major=116 snd_cards_limit=1
 alias snd-card-0 snd-card-emu10k1
 
 # OSS portion
 
 alias char-major-14 soundcore
 alias sound-slot-0 snd-card-0
 alias sound-service-0-0 snd-mixer-oss
 alias sound-service-0-1 snd-seq-oss
 alias sound-service-0-3 snd-pcm-oss
 alias sound-service-0-8 snd-seq-oss
 alias sound-service-0-12 snd-pcm-oss
 
 ============ eof ==================
 
 в общем, все как надо там настроили как INSTALLах написано... уря. Грузимся,
 oss-игралочки нормально играют mp3 (в противном случае не забудьте пустить
 alsamixer и настроить уровни громкостей!), поъlsmodъвидимъновыеъмодули, но
 никакого midi не слышно...
 
 Что дальше? А дальше качаем такую штучку, называется Linux AWE driver source and
 utilities. В Debian это пакет awe-drv (у меня стоит версия 0.4.3.1-1.2, кажись, 
 из woody aka testing). Про другие дистрибуции я не знаю... накрайняк придется
 поискать в альтависте :) Hа самом-то деле во всем этом пакете нас интересует
 одна-единственная утилита sfxload (наверное, можно утянуть откуда-нибудь только 
 ее, не знаю).
 
 Когда у нас есть эта радостная утилита, запускаем ее, давая в качестве параметра
 имя файлика формата .sf2 с сэмплами, то есть, примерно так:
 
 sfxload /mnt/d/Program\ Files/Creative/SBLive/SFBank/8mbgmsfx.sf2
 
 А теперь пускаем какой-нибудь подходящий midi player и радуемся :)
 
 Да, смотрим lsmod'ом на то, сколько новых интересных драйверов загрузилось on
 demand после загрузки сэмплов и никак не нарадуемся :)
 
 Прописываем запуск sfxload'а в какой-нибудь загрузочный скрипт.
 
 Опционально находим в интернете более качественный .sf2, чем в дистрибутиве
 Creative (встречал много ссылок на какой-то chaos12mb.sf2 или чего-то в этом
 роде. сам не пробовал).
 
 все :)
 
 P.S. При чем здесь awe? Hу, наверное, интерфейс загрузки семплов один и тот же. 
 Hе знаю, в общем. В любом случае, это работает.
 
 P.P.S. А находил я это решение только для того, чтобы в Doom с музыкой играть :)
  MZ> Registered Linux user # 224587
 
 Сколько раз уже встречал что-то подобное. Что это за регистрация такая хитрая?
 Cheers!
 
 --- GoldED+/LNX 1.1.5 - 10 years of evolution can't be wrong!
  * Origin: Just curious... (2:5020/2046.4)
 
 

Вернуться к списку тем, сортированных по: возрастание даты  уменьшение даты  тема  автор 

 Тема:    Автор:    Дата:  
 Kernel 2.4.8   Konstantin Isakov   24 Aug 2001 16:50:36 
 Kernel 2.4.8   Maxim Zubkov   27 Aug 2001 01:18:20 
Архивное /ru.linux/39023b864dad.html, оценка 2 из 5, голосов 10
Яндекс.Метрика
Valid HTML 4.01 Transitional